Output c9660972536b331facfcb9a653dc7cad7d7ff5460ea172190466b98f059822e6:4

value
27486139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bf76b9e434d4547053a1d81852b9102a316f761 OP_EQUAL
address
MEpqJtQUXVCZnw4g5GR3EQAA52EuDjtD53
transaction
c9660972536b331facfcb9a653dc7cad7d7ff5460ea172190466b98f059822e6
spent
true